Recently, the US Consumer Protection Commission ( CPSC) issued a danger warning on two magnetic ball toy sets sold on the Temu platform. In the warning notice, the CPSC stated that consumers should immediately stop using these two products because they are composed of multiple loose small magnetic balls, which may cause serious injury or even death to children if swallowed by mistake.
1. Sunny House 125-Piece 5mm Mixed Color Magnetic Ball Toy Set
According to the notice, the product consists of 125 colorful small magnetic spheres with strong magnetic flux. They can be combined into a cube or separated individually and sold in a transparent and portable plastic box.
The products were sold by Chinese seller Sunny House on the Temu platform between April and May 2023, with prices ranging from US$8 to US$19. 2. Ming Tai Trade 216 5mm Magnetic Ball Set
This product consists of 216 colorful 5mm magnetic balls, which are loose and small in size, but have strong magnetic flux. They are combined into a cube by magnetic attraction, and can also be separated and sold in a transparent and portable plastic box.
The goods were sold by Chinese seller Ming Tai Trade on the Temu platform in May 2023 for between US$10 and US$25. The CPSC said that after testing, these magnetic ball sets do not meet the requirements of federal toy regulations because they contain one or more magnets. According to the definition of small cylindrical parts by the US CPSC, the regulations will have higher requirements for magnetic parts. When parts with strong magnets are accidentally ingested by children and retained in the digestive system, they may cause intestinal perforation, twisting, blockage, infection, blood poisoning and death.
According to CPSC statistics, between 2017 and 2021, 2,400 cases of accidental ingestion of magnets were reported to emergency departments in U.S. hospitals. CPSC is aware of seven deaths, two of which occurred outside the United States.
The CPSC has issued violation notices to two sellers, Sunny House and Ming Tai Trade. Currently, neither seller has agreed to recall the products or provide consumers with remedies such as refunds. Temu CPSC commodity |
